Building Resilience Through Lifestyle Choices
Resilience is the ability to bounce back from adversity, a vital competency in managing mental health. Building resilience involves adopting healthy lifestyle choices that support mental wellness. Engaging in regular physical activity, maintaining a balanced diet, and ensuring adequate sleep are foundational elements. These aspects of self-care enhance mental clarity and emotional stability, better equipping individuals to handle stress.
Additionally, cultivating positive habits like mindfulness and meditation can significantly boost resilience. These practices enhance self-awareness and help individuals navigate emotions more effectively. Incorporating mindfulness into daily routines fosters a sense of calm and perspective, which are invaluable when dealing with life's uncertainties. By prioritizing these lifestyle choices, mental resilience becomes an attainable goal.
The Role of Social Connections
Social connections play a profound role in mental health. Strong relationships with friends, family, and colleagues can provide emotional support, enriching one's life. In modern society, where remote work and digital communication are prevalent, maintaining social ties is more important than ever. Regular interaction with a supportive community bolsters mental health, offering assistance and understanding during challenging times.
Developing and nurturing these connections requires effort and communication. Engaging in social activities, whether virtual or in person, helps strengthen these bonds. Sharing experiences and emotions with others engenders a sense of belonging, which is crucial for mental well-being. By valuing and prioritizing relationships, individuals can enhance their support networks, contributing significantly to their mental wellness journey.
Practical Strategies for Mental Well-Being
Implementing practical strategies is paramount to maintaining mental health in the modern age. Setting realistic goals and taking time to unwind are effective ways to manage stress. Incorporating breaks into busy schedules and engaging in hobbies or creative outlets can rejuvenate the mind. These strategies allow for mental rest and recovery, preventing burnout and enhancing overall health.
Regularly assessing and adjusting mental health strategies ensures they stay relevant and effective. An openness to change can lead to discovering new methods for coping with stress. Seeking professional help when needed is also crucial – therapy and counseling provide invaluable support and guidance. By applying these strategies and remaining proactive, individuals can thrive mentally and emotionally, achieving a state of well-being that supports both personal and professional aspirations.
